forked from loafle/openapi-generator-original
* fix: remove option supportPython2.
[python-flask][python-aiohttp][python-blueplanet]
* fix: update samples
* test only python servers
* fix(tests): downgrade pytest version to ensure compatibility with python3.6 [python-flask][python-aiohttp]
* Revert "fix(tests): downgrade pytest version to ensure compatibility with python3.6 [python-flask][python-aiohttp]"
This reverts commit 9f47db2f87.
* test in circlei
* run commands directly
* test in node 1
* update makefile
* fix Makefile
* fix test
* revert some changes, remove python server tests from travis
Co-authored-by: Kevin Bannier <kevinbannier1@gmail.com>
openapi_server Swagger-ui and Resource Types
This project is an autogenerated microservice for Ciena's Blueplanet platform.
Overview
Generated code can be used as:
- Resource Type generation for Resource Adapter Development
- Resource Type generation for Service Template Development
- Microservice for swagger based NBI
Make Targets:
image: Create Docker image for use as BluePlanet microservice solution: Create Solution image
Resource Types are generated in model-definitions directory
Usage
Creating new release
-
Update RELEASE property in Makefile
-
Update release(s) in fig.yml
-
make image and solution
# building the image make image make solution
Iterative Development
-
A helper target can be used for pushing image and solution to server
make update REMOTE_SERVER=bpadmin@10.10.10.10
This make target does the following:
- creates App and Solution image
- purges solution from MCP remote
- pushes solution and image to MCP remote
- deploys solution
Local Usage
To run the server locally:
cd app
pip3 install -r requirements.txt
python3 -m swagger_server
and open your browser to here